Microbial Fuel Cells (MFCs) are considered a sustainable energy source due to their unique operational principles:
Statement 1 is correct: MFCs utilize living microorganisms, primarily bacteria, as biocatalysts. These microbes oxidize organic substrates, such as glucose or organic waste, in an anaerobic environment. During this metabolic process, electrons are released and subsequently transferred to an anode, generating an electrical current. This biological conversion of chemical energy into electrical energy is a core aspect of their sustainability.
Statement 3 is correct: MFCs can be effectively integrated into wastewater treatment plants. In such applications, they serve a dual purpose: treating organic pollutants present in wastewater by degrading them, and simultaneously producing electricity. This capability offers an environmentally friendly approach to waste management while also generating renewable energy, contributing significantly to their sustainability profile.

Statement 2 is incorrect: MFCs primarily rely on organic materials as substrates for microbial metabolism and electricity generation. The microorganisms require carbon-based compounds for their metabolic processes. While specific designs might involve certain inorganic electron acceptors or mediators, the fundamental energy source for MFCs is organic matter, not a wide variety of inorganic materials.
